Reply to “Comment on ‘Normalization of quasinormal modes in leaky optical cavities and plasmonic resonators' ”

2017· article· en· W2406505196 on OpenAlexfundno aff
Philip Trøst Kristensen, Rong-Chun Ge, Stephen Hughes

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

We refute all claims of the ``Comment on `Normalization of quasinormal modes in leaky optical cavities and plasmonic resonators' '' by E. A. Muljarov and W. Langbein. Based entirely on information already contained in our original article [P. T. Kristensen, R.-C. Ge, and S. Hughes, Phys. Rev. A 92, 053810 (2015)], we dismiss every point of criticism as being unsupported and point out how important parts of our argumentation appear to have been overlooked by the Comment authors. In addition, we provide additional calculations showing directly the connection between the normalizations by Sauvan et al. and Muljarov et al., which were not included in our original article.
